What is Marketing?

At its core, marketing is about communicating value. It is the process of identifying, anticipating, and satisfying customer needs and wants through various means, including product development, pricing strategies, distribution channels, and promotional efforts. Marketing can be viewed as both an art and a science, requiring creativity to craft compelling messages and analytical skills to understand market trends and consumer data.

Types of Marketing Strategies

Marketing strategies can be broadly categorized into various types, including:

  • Differentiation Marketing: Focusing on what makes your product unique compared to competitors.
  • Cost Leadership: Offering the lowest prices in the industry to attract price-sensitive customers.
  • Focus Marketing: Targeting a specific market segment or niche.
  • Integrated Marketing: Coordinating multiple marketing channels to deliver a unified message.

Understanding these strategies helps businesses select the appropriate approach based on their goals and resources.

Defining Your Target Audience

The success of your marketing efforts hinges on knowing your target audience. Defining your ideal customer involves analyzing demographics, psychographics, and behavioral traits. Techniques for identifying your target audience include:

  1. Market Research: Surveys and questionnaires help gather valuable insights directly from potential consumers.
  2. A/B Testing: Experimenting with different marketing messages to see which resonates best.
  3. Create Buyer Personas: Developing fictional representations of your ideal customers based on data and research.

By accurately defining your target audience, you can tailor your marketing campaigns effectively.

SEO: The Backbone of Online Presence

Search Engine Optimization (SEO) is a fundamental aspect of digital marketing aimed at improving a website’s visibility on search engines. Effective SEO strategies involve:

  • Keyword Research: Identifying relevant keywords that potential customers are searching for.
  • On-Page SEO: Optimizing individual web pages to rank higher and earn more relevant traffic.
  • Off-Page SEO: Building relationships and creating backlinks from reputable sources.

Implementing a robust SEO strategy ensures your business is easily discoverable online, ultimately leading to increased traffic and conversions.

Social Media Marketing Best Practices

Social media platforms provide powerful venues for businesses to engage with their audience directly. Best practices for successful social media marketing include:

  1. Consistent Branding: Ensure that your brand message and visuals are consistent across all platforms.
  2. Engagement: Actively respond to comments and messages to build stronger community ties.
  3. Content Diversity: Utilize various content types, including videos, images, and polls to keep audiences engaged.

When utilized effectively, social media marketing can significantly enhance brand awareness and customer loyalty.

Email Marketing: Engaging Your Clients

Email marketing remains one of the most effective methods for communicating with customers. Key tactics include:

  • Personalization: Tailoring your emails based on user behavior and preferences to increase relevance.
  • Segmentation: Dividing your email list into targeted groups based on demographics or behavior.
  • Compelling CTAs: Encourage readers to take specific actions with clear and attractive calls-to-action.

By creating targeted email campaigns, businesses can enhance customer relationships and drive conversions.

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) to Track

KPIs help gauge the effectiveness of marketing strategies. Important KPIs might include:

  • Return on Investment (ROI): Evaluates profitability of marketing efforts.
  • Customer Acquisition Cost (CAC): Measures cost-effectiveness of acquiring new customers.
  • Conversion Rate: Indicates the percentage of visitors who complete a desired action.

Regularly reviewing these KPIs can enhance future marketing decisions.

What is a marketing mix?

The marketing mix refers to a combination of strategies a company uses to promote and sell its products, traditionally comprising the 4 Ps: Product, Price, Place, and Promotion.
